Image copyright is the legal ownership of an image. Anyone who creates an image holds its copyright, including the exclusive rights to copy or reproduce it. This is automatic: Copyright exists even if the creator never registers their work with a copyright office.

How to check the copyright for an image? Look for an image credit or contact details. Look for a watermark. Check the images metadata. Do a Google reverse image search. Search the U.S. Copyright Office Database. +1. If in doubt, dont use it.
